Layout
The entrance leads into a hallway with stairs to the upper floor and access to the living room. The bright living room, with a dining area at the rear, forms a welcoming space with room for a large dining table. The kitchen extends from the living room and is conveniently arranged. From the living room, there is access to the basement—ideal as a pantry or for additional storage. Adjacent to the kitchen is a small hallway with access to the toilet and a neatly finished bathroom, equipped with a shower, sink, and washing machine connection.
On the first floor, there are two bedrooms. The landing features a built-in sink with cabinet space, adding extra comfort and storage. The second floor offers a third bedroom and a spacious storage area under the sloping roof at the front of the house.
Outdoor space
The backyard is one of the true highlights of this home: wonderfully deep, sunny, and ideally facing south. At the rear is a spacious garden house/storage unit fitted with 12 solar panels (installed in 2015), perfect for use as a hobby room, workspace, or extra storage.
